Tires with Incorrect Date Code/FMVSS 119

Recalled: October 31, 2022 ~119 units affected 22T020

Description

Yokohama Off-Highway Tires America, Inc (YOHTA) is recalling certain Alliance High Speed Rib Implement Tire 12.5L-15 FI, 11L-15FI, Primex Highway R-550 Steer and Trailer 11-22.5, Alliance 317 Implement 10.5-20 IMP, and Alliance Stubble Proof 319 SPH 11L-15FI tires. The date code portion of the Tire Identification Number (TIN) states the incorrect manufacture date on the sidewall of the tire. As such, these tires f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 119, "New Pneumatic Tires, Other than Passenger Cars."

Injuries / Consequence

The incorrect date code hinders drivers from accurately identifying the age of the tire and makes it difficult to determine if the tire is affected by a safety recall, which can increase the risk of a crash.

Remedy

YOHTA will replace the affected tires,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ed February 1, 2023. Owners may contact YOHTA's customer service at 1-800-343-3276.
